Hi Linus,
Please consider applying these patches for liblockdep, or alternatively
pull from:
git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/sashal/linux.git tags/liblockdep-fixes-040820
The patches fix up compilation and functionality of liblockdep on 5.8,
they were tested using liblockdep's internal testsuite.
I was unable to get the x86 folks to pull these fixes for the past few
months:
- https://lkml.org/lkml/2020/2/17/1089
- https://lkml.org/lkml/2020/4/18/817
- https://lkml.org/lkml/2020/6/22/1262
Which is why this pull request ends up going straight to you.
